The F80 Is Ferrari's Anniversary Statement

Ferrari created the 2025 F80 to celebrate its 80th anniversary. The result is a road car designed to demonstrate just how far the company can push modern performance technology.

With 1,200 horsepower, the F80 is officially Ferrari's most powerful road-legal car. Its powertrain combines electrification with Ferrari's performance engineering, creating a vehicle designed around extreme acceleration and high-speed capability.

The car's braking system was co-developed with Brembo, ensuring that the stopping hardware is capable of handling the enormous performance available from the powertrain.

Massive Downforce Changes the Formula

The F80 is not dependent solely on horsepower. Its aerodynamic design can produce approximately 1,050 kilograms of downforce, giving the car significant grip at speed.

For virtual drivers, this feature can make the F80 particularly rewarding to explore. High downforce can influence cornering behavior and allow drivers to carry substantial speed through bends.

Ferrari's decision to manufacture the electric motor completely in-house also makes the F80 historically interesting. It demonstrates the company's growing involvement in electric powertrain technology while maintaining its traditional focus on performance.

The GTAm Turns a Sedan Into a Weapon

Alfa Romeo takes a different route with the 2021 Giulia GTAm. The starting point is already impressive: the Giulia Quadrifoglio. The GTAm then removes the rear seats, introduces a roll cage, and upgrades the V6 engine to 533 horsepower.

The changes are designed to make the car considerably more focused on performance. It can accelerate from zero to 60 mph in just 3.6 seconds, placing it firmly among serious performance machines.

Yet the GTAm remains road legal. That combination makes it especially interesting because drivers can enjoy its motorsport-inspired engineering without needing a dedicated race car.

Racing Professionals Helped Shape the Car

The GTAm's aerodynamic development was handled with assistance from Sauber, which used its wind tunnel to develop the car's new aerodynamic components.

Kimi Räikkönen, a Formula 1 World Champion, also helped refine the final details. His involvement connects the GTAm directly to professional racing expertise.

The result is a vehicle that combines Alfa Romeo's road-car heritage with knowledge gained from high-level motorsport.

The SE 048SP Goes Fully Racing

The 1990 Alfa Romeo SE 048SP represents a much more specialized machine. Alfa Romeo developed the prototype with Group C racing in mind, initially intending it to replace the Lancia LC2.

The project eventually used a Ferrari-sourced 3.5-liter V12 producing roughly 680 horsepower. Its carbon-fiber monocoque and aerodynamic bodywork were designed for the demands of endurance competition.

Unlike the road-focused F80 and GTAm, the SE 048SP was created around racing requirements. Its aggressive construction reflects an era when manufacturers used endurance racing to showcase advanced engineering.
